Outline of Final Research Achievements |
This study demonstrates and analytically discussed that a magnetic film becomes transparent for the magnetic flux when the relative permeability of the magnetic film becomes negative above the intrinsic ferromagnetic resonance frequency. The shielding effectiveness of the magnetic flux through the magnetic film was evaluated by a magnetic circuit considering leakage magnetic flux from the magnetic film and demonstrated by the near field measurement using shielded loop coil type magnetic field probe. In this case, the coplanar and microstrip transmission lines was developed as a flux source. As a result, it was clarified that the magnetic flux in the magnetic circuit increases when the magnetic circuit resonated with a negative reluctance of magnetic film. Therefore, the magnetic film can behave as a bandpass filter.
